Buy a small home safe that you can use to keep your valuables in. This is vital if you don’t want diamonds, gold or other personal items exposed to a home intruder. Keep your safe in your basement or attic to make it hard to find.

It is important for your home to always look lived in. You can purchase inexpensive timers that will control different electronics and lights in your home. This will make your home appear as if someone is there. This is an effective deterrent against burglars.

Purchase ceiling, flooring and roofing that is fire resistant. This adds more protection to a house, especially if you’re in a dry area with some power lines. You can enhance home safety with excellent fire precautions.

You should always change the locks after purchasing a home. Many people may have been given keys by the former owner. Get a locksmith in right away. Make sure you do the same thing if you lose your keys sometime.

You should never give details about your vacations and other plans on social networks. While these platforms are there for sharing, this is announcing to the world that your home is an open target.

When looking to buy a security system, shop around. Several different firms may offer similar protection for wildly divergent prices. Make sure you get quotes from at least three companies before you decide on which one you think is the best option.

If you have a stranger at your door, do not open it. People are coming up with all sorts of ways to convince people to open their door to them, with the intent of committing burglary or worse. Secure your garage. There is a solution for people that are worried about burglars going into their home through an attached garage. Use a C-clamp to secure the door if it’s off track.

Consider the advice of your friends when selecting your home security company. You can benefit from the experience of others that have gone before you by paying attention to their recommendations and warnings. Ask a few different people to help you make the best choice.

In the summer, remove all the dead trees from your yard. Due to the heat, these items in your yard are more likely to catch on fire. As a result, your home could be caught on fire. Clear yard regularly to maintain your house safe.

Don’t make a habit of giving strangers access to your home. There are some people who are very convincing and good at getting you to let them into your house. Some people will knock on your door simply to see whether you have a security system.

Do not be shy. Engage your neighbors in conversation. By knowing the people in your neighborhood, you can rest a little easier knowing that people are looking out for each other. Listen to gossip also. Important security details (like the presence of strangers in your neighborhood) can come out of the most innocent conversations.

Install motion-sensor lights. The motion sensors turn on the lights whenever anyone approaches your home. This is a good way of knowing who comes near your home and keeps you safe if you ever come home late. Replace bulbs regularly and check the sensors once a month.

The alarm system you choose should protect more than just the doors to your home. Thieves can easily enter your home through a window. Therefore, ensure the windows have an attached alarm. All potential entry points should have an alarm. With this method, your family will be safer.

If you have skylights, do not neglect them when making sure your home is secure. Although a skylight can bring light into one’s home and look good, it’s also a common entrance way for burglars. Your skylights need durable and reliable hardware for true protection.

Obtain flashlights with solid batteries, and ensure they are kept in all the rooms of your home in the event of a power outage. They will help you get around in case your entire home is dark. Your kids should know how to work the flashlights so that everyone can help.

Don’t put your extra key under you doormat, in a planter, or in a cleverly disguised false rock. These seem like great places for you when you misplace your key. Burglars are well aware of these hiding places. Rather, give your spare key to a neighbor or friend that you trust.

Landscape your home with safety in mind. All of your windows and doors should be unobstructed by plants, shrubs, trees or fences. If they can be seen, there will be no place to hide. Landscaped features should be set further away for safety, yet keeping beauty in mind.

Be certain the wires to your home security system are neither visible nor accessible. An intruder can cut the wires or disconnect them and avoid the system. Instead, make sure the wires are hidden. This will add security.

Were you aware of how valuable your house wires are? Lots of people fail to appreciate this until they are hit by thieves. The copper component of wiring is very valuable and may be stripped from the outside of your home in a fairly short amount of time. Be sure to keep your wiring hidden or difficult to reach.

Think about a wireless security system for your home. It may cost less to get a wired system; however, rewiring to accommodate the system may be difficult. Additionally, power outages may negatively impact your system. Also, you will have a very easy time installing them.

When you are trying to hire a home security contractor, read all the small print on your contract before signing it. There may be hidden costs to doing business with them, including early termination fees and surprising equipment costs. You should avoid such expenses if you can, so make yourself aware.

You need a home security system. You can have great home security with both hidden and visible video cameras. While a visible camera is a deterrent, a burglar might try to disable the camera, but a separate hidden camera can solve this problem. You can sometimes access security systems using your cell phone, keeping you informed on the go.

It is better to buy your home security system directly from the security company instead of from a dealer. Resellers just want to make money off your purchase, but they don’t give guarantees. If you deal directly with the security company, you will not incur added fees and you can be assured that your equipment will be serviced by the company.

Don’t leave the boxes of any high priced electronics on the curb of your house. Burglars pay attention to this, and it will make them want to break in and get the items. Cut up the boxes completely instead.

If you use window air conditioning units, be certain they are secured well and are surrounded by bars. Burglars often remove window air conditioners for easy access to homes. You should actually remove them from your windows during winter.
